A Phase II Clinical Trial of Denileukin Diftitox in Combination With Rituximab in Previously Untreated Follicular B-Cell Non-Hodgkin's Lymphoma

Alliance for Clinical Trials in Oncology·interventional·Posted Apr 13, 2007·Updated Apr 18, 2017

In Brief

A Phase 2 clinical trial evaluating denileukin diftitox and rituximab for Lymphoma. Completed, enrolled 24 participants across 165 sites.

Detailed Summary

RATIONALE: Monoclonal antibodies, such as rituximab, can block cancer growth in different ways. Some block the ability of cancer cells to grow and spread. Others find cancer cells and help kill them or carry cancer-killing substances to them. Combinations of biological substances in denileukin diftitox may be able to carry cancer-killing substances directly to cancer cells. Giving rituximab together with denileukin diftitox may kill more cancer cells. PURPOSE: This phase II trial is studying how well giving rituximab together with denileukin diftitox works in treating patients with previously untreated stage III or stage IV follicular B-cell non-Hodgkin's lymphoma.
